Derived from the Arabic root _n-ṣ-r_ meaning "victory," Mansoor is a masculine name that directly translates to "victorious" or "one who is helped to triumph." It appears in the Quran in the context of divine support, and is found across the Muslim world in various spellings, including Mansur, Mansour, and Mansor. A prominent bearer was Abu Jafar al-Mansur, the second Abbasid caliph who founded Baghdad in the 8th century.
